What was this vote about?

This vote concerned “Gaza at breaking point: EU action to combat famine and the urgent need to release hostages and move towards a two-state solution”. S&D, Greens-EFA, Left and NI voted mostly in favour, while EPP, PfE, ECR, Renew and ESN voted mostly against. The motion was rejected by a comfortable margin (172 for, 379 against, 35 abstentions).
